Explanation:

Step1: Recall dominant - recessive rules

In genetics, dominant allele (E) masks recessive allele (e). Small - eared mice must have ee genotype as they show the recessive trait.

Step2: Analyze parent genotypes

Since the parents have big ears, they must have at least one E allele. And since they can produce small - eared (ee) offspring, they must each carry an e allele.

Step3: Determine parent genotypes

If both parents are Ee, when they reproduce, using a Punnett - square analysis, the possible genotypes of their offspring are EE:Ee:ee in a ratio of 1:2:1. This can result in both big - eared (EE or Ee) and small - eared (ee) offspring.

Answer:

B. Both parents are Ee
